Hi Ammar,
Please find proper values for 'query points' as defined by the variable "Points" here.
Also, provide a Value for variable "KI" as it should be of the same length as the variable "TI."
Below is an example of doing so.
%% b)
% K100 must be present so that the outside temperature does not reach 100 degrees Celsius (373 K)
% u (0.02) must be a function of K, then change K,
% u (0.02) change until we reach a value less than 373K
KI = [1 10 20 30 40];
TI = [717.1204 670.6470 629.6585 596.6963 373];
Points = [1:0.1:40];
I = interp1(KI,TI,Points,'spline');
plot(I)
Please refer to the MATLAB Documentation page on 'interp1'.
